Block

#20,850,664
Block Number
20,850,664 @ 02/08/2025, 17:24:50
Status
Finalized
ID
0x013e27e8e32aed91ae4509530a7634d544dd01201dda555b34bfb8ff3ae2d3a2
Transactions
Gas Used
4839045/40000000 (12.10% Used)
Total Score
2,035,612,654 (+98)
Rewards
16.47 VTHO